Output 8dc6f5465c37e3084153d8bdc223d0fc8a48888e968a032b734b3bcef0e18b92:3

value
310000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9143298f0805cb26a150ef4d12cb475dd3329a6 OP_EQUAL
address
3QQ2NfcejU5L2PRMSZnqhfJvchscdFAMXY
transaction
8dc6f5465c37e3084153d8bdc223d0fc8a48888e968a032b734b3bcef0e18b92
confirmations
291141
spent
true